Travel website TripAdvisor has just released their ‘Top Destinations On The Rise – Asia’ list, and three Malaysian cities made the cut.
Kuching, Kota Kinbalu and George Town came in at the eighth, ninth and tenth spot respectively.
According to TripAdvisor, Kuching is a “fine choice for an enriching vacation that’s as packed with learning as it is leisure.” The website points to Kuching’s street food and massive Sunday market as the main draw of the city.
In choosing Kota Kinabalu, TripAdvisor wrote that the Kinabalu National Park is the must-visit spot in the city. Its wide variety of outdoor activites such as hiking to the top of Mount Kinabalu, the tallest mountain in Malaysia, as well as jungle trekking and camping at the Crocker Range National Park make Kota Kinabalu a dream come true for adventurous travelers.
As for George Town, the travel site notes that the town’s beauty and rich history keeps tourists flocking all year round. Its reputation as a food heaven helps too!
Here’s the full TripAdvisor’s ‘Top 10 Destinations of the Rise – Asia’ list:
1) Baku, Azerbaijan
2) El Nido, Philippines
3) Jodhpur, India
4) Da Lat, Vietnam
5) Jeju, South Korea
6) Sapa, Vietnam
7) Hualien, Taiwan
8) Kuching, Malaysia
9) Kota Kinabalu, Malaysia
10) George Town, Malaysia
